Output 10eec768ebdad2eea38d2a07efd4058eb7e9a5a8989f14654143e8ef9805df5b:379

value
1171873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ec407d6d52f4b7f9617223be72118f4374854d7e OP_EQUAL
address
3PECeezwcfXWmTSBUhU4poWLLp1qLRmSph
transaction
10eec768ebdad2eea38d2a07efd4058eb7e9a5a8989f14654143e8ef9805df5b
confirmations
395003
spent
true